"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ator - locator.exe" Service on Windows 8
What is "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" in my Windows 8 service list? And how is "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" service related to locator.exe?

"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" is a Windows 8 service.
In Windows 2003 and earlier versions of Windows, the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ator service manages the
RPC name service database. In Windows Vista and later versions of Windows, this service does not provide any
functionality and is present for application compatibility.
"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" service is provided by locator.exe program file.
Detailed information on "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" service:
Service name: RpcLocator Display name: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ator Execution command: C:\Windows\system32\locator.exe Dependencies: None
"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" service is provided by a program called: locator.exe:
Name: locator.exe Location: C:\Windows\system32\locator.exe Description: Rpc Locator File version: 6.2.9200.16384 (win8_rtm.120725-1247) Size: 9728 bytes Modified: 7/26/2012 3:08:32 AM UTC
Disabling "Remote Procedure Call (RPC) Locator" service should not cause any issues when running Windows 8 system.
